Output 45d830cea4cf983fee6436196dbe84a1fde858f5b449eaad32b73092c3fae7d2:12

value
106500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71db479f809f42ff5ec0ebf5185bce24acd5e616 OP_EQUAL
address
3C52y3f9MijwcRTFZXGaHn785AbEhSm7cB
transaction
45d830cea4cf983fee6436196dbe84a1fde858f5b449eaad32b73092c3fae7d2
confirmations
1453
spent
true